Runbook: LockerLoop escalation

If a resident's laundry-locker unlock fails twice, the Spindle app falls back to the kiosk PIN flow. If the kiosk is also down, don't reboot the hub yourself — it wipes pending unlock tokens. Page the LockerLoop on-call first, and if nobody bites within 15 minutes, escalate to the facilities duty desk at the address below.

alerts address for bawif-hahig: norwyn_gorys_lamath@olvarqlabs.test

### Account Recovery — Catalogue Import (Lintwood)

Quick one for review: when the Lintwood catalogue import wipes a patron's session table, the recovery flow re-seeds accounts from the nightly snapshot. Check that the importer skips locked accounts — last time it didn't. To rerun recovery against staging you'll need the vault passphrase, which is appended just below.

recovery phrase for yafof-tajof: julmir-kelax-julvan-holath-belvan-holir-ralael-ralvan-ralath-julvan-silmir-istmir-kaswyn-ulamir

Ticket: Crashfall ingest failing on staging

New folks, please read carefully. The Pebblekit mobile app's crash reports aren't reaching the symbolication queue because staging's env file was copied without its upload credential. Symptoms: 401s in the collector logs every five minutes. To fix, add the missing line to the env file, exactly as follows.

secret setting of fafop-tagep: VAULT_KEY29=6a815d21e2d77cc25ef1802d73ee6